Like the UR_22c sound card and I think the other UR’s too, as @Daniel said are drivers are not multi-client capable on Windows.
I use voicemeeter banana because the latency is low and everything works perfectly. I use a lot of different software and have had to test a lot of things to have performance/simplicity to also work in parallel with video capture software and others. (obsstudio, screenpresso, Snagit, after effects, etc.)
One of my observations is that as soon as you have to change the settings in the sound windows pages and change settings and choices above all, you are quickly confronted with recurring problems and it quickly turns into a nightmare: it works a step and the next day it doesn’t work anymore, etc. and we start again, we try to open one program before the other, etc…
